Taco Bell is a globally recognized fast-food restaurant chain specializing in Mexican-inspired cuisine. Founded in 1962, Taco Bell has grown into one of the largest and most successful quick-service restaurant brands worldwide, known for its innovative menu, vibrant atmosphere, and commitment to customer satisfaction. The company operates thousands of locations across the United States and internationally, offering a unique blend of bold flavors, fast service, and value-driven meals that attract a diverse customer base. Taco Bell emphasizes high standards of food quality, cleanliness, and hospitality, making it a leader in the fast-food industry.

Job Duties
- Ensure cost control for food, labor, cash, and controllable expenses to meet company budgets
- Drive positive sales growth by improving service speed, food quality, and customer satisfaction metrics
- Maintain adequate staffing levels for all shifts and scheduling needs
- Conduct performance appraisals for crew members, shift managers, and assistant general managers
- Lead the hiring process for all restaurant staff positions
- Coach and train all team members to achieve certification and performance standards
- Maintain cleanliness and organization adhering to food service sanitation guidelines
- Ensure compliance with employment laws at local, state, and federal levels
- Verify and promote safety standards for employees and guests
- Oversee preventative maintenance and coordinate necessary repairs
- Handle guest complaints to promote repeat business
- Communicate operational results effectively with area management
- Manage employee turnover through effective selection and positive work environment
- Prepare food and handle register operations as needed
